Apr 2, 2019 · 5. Don’t forget context. When it comes to training your dog to come when called and achieving a truly reliable recall, context is important. This means that reliably coming when called in the living room is not predictive of your dog coming when called in the yard or at the park.

Punishment may also lead to your dog biting someone else without warning. , May 12, 2021 · The bell can quickly become a clear way for your dog to tell you they need a potty break. Step 1: Teach your dog to "nose target" the bell to make it jingle. Hold the bells close to your dog's nose and let them investigate. If they sniff, touch, or boop the bell, mark and reinforce with a favorite treat. When you see these signs, immediately grab the ..., Teach your dog that cup equals treats. The first step to teaching your dog the shell game is to teach them that the cup means dog treats. To do this, put a treat in a cup and set it in front of your dog. Then have your dog get the treat out of the cup.
